                                 JUDGMENT

Aggrieved by Ext.P1 order of assessment relating to assessment year 2016-17, petitioner has preferred an appeal before the 2nd respondent, a copy of which is produced as Ext.P2. A petition for stay of proceedings pursuant to the assessment order has also been filed as Ext.P3. Petitioner apprehends coercive proceedings even before the petition for stay is considered. Hence, this writ petition.

2. Having considered the submissions of the counsel for the petitioner as well as the respondents, I am of the opinion that this writ petition itself can be disposed with a direction.

3. Accordingly, there will be a direction to the 2nd respondent to consider and pass orders on Ext.P3 stay petition, within a period of two months from the date of receipt of a copy of this judgment. Till such a decision is taken, all coercive proceedings against the petitioner in respect of Ext.P1 shall be kept in abeyance.

The writ petition is disposed of as above.
